Guianan Squirrel vs Ring-necked Duck
Sciurus aestuans compared with Aythya collaris
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Guianan Squirrel | Ring-necked Duck |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Anseriformes (Anseriformes)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Anatidae |
| Genus | Sciurus (Tree Squirrels) | Aythya |
| Species | Sciurus aestuans | Aythya collaris |
Evolutionary Relationship
Guianan Squirrel and Ring-necked Duck share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
